Windows: Installing S-TAP agent by using the interactive installer
The interactive installer is useful for smaller deployments or whenever a guided, step-by-step installation experience is required.
Before you begin
- Review the Windows S-TAP® installation requirements at Windows: Prerequisites: installing S-TAP.
- Verify that your database server and operating system are supported. For more information, see System Requirements for Guardium® 11.3 and Windows: S-TAP monitoring mechanisms support matrix.
- Identify the IP address of the database server where you are installing the S-TAP, including any virtual IP addresses.
- Identify the IP address of the Guardium system that will control the S-TAP.
- Verify that the intended S-TAP installation directory is empty or does not exist.
- Obtain the S-TAP module from either Fix Central, or from your Guardium representative.
About this task
When you install an S-TAP on a database server, you must provide the IP address or host name of the Guardium system that will receive data from the S-TAP. After the S-TAP has connected to the Guardium system, go to the page and complete the S-TAP configuration.
If you want to disable auto-discovery, clear the Start S-Tap Service checkbox. For more information, see Windows: Auto discovery of database instances during installation and upgrade.
- You can change some Windows S-TAP parameters from the interactive installer (but not all). Use the GUI after you install the S-TAP to change S-TAP parameters that you can't change from the installer.
When you install an S-TAP from the wizard, you can uninstall it from the wizard, the command line, or Windows Add/Remove Programs.
